AI / ML Engineer (Applied AI & Automations) We are a fast‑growing SaaS company on a mission to propel the restoration industry forward by empowering restoration companies with the technology they need to scale and grow their businesses. Recently voted a Top 10 Start‑up in Chicago by LinkedIn and a Top Start‑up by Built In, and backed by Y Combinator, this is an exciting time to join our team as we enter a stage of rapid growth and product expansion.

We’re looking for an AI / ML Engineer to help us build production‑grade AI systems that power real operational workflows across our platform. This role is hands‑on and highly impactful — you’ll work on NLP, LLM‑powered features, AI‑driven automations, and scalable machine learning systems that are actively used by customers.

You’ll collaborate closely with product, engineering, and leadership, owning AI features end‑to‑end — from data and models to APIs and production deployment — while helping shape the future of AI at Albi.

Key Responsibilities

Design, build, and deploy applied AI and ML features used in production environments

Develop NLP and LLM‑based systems (classification, extraction, summarization, QA, RAG)

Build and maintain AI‑driven workflows and automations integrated with core product logic

Design and implement backend services and APIs to support AI inference and data processing

Work with embeddings, vector search, and retrieval‑augmented generation (RAG) pipelines

Train, fine‑tune, and optimize domain‑specific machine learning models

Improve model performance across accuracy, latency, reliability, and cost

Deploy and monitor ML systems in cloud environments

Collaborate closely with product managers and engineers to deliver impactful AI features

Participate in architectural decisions, code reviews, and technical planning

Contribute to testing, monitoring, and continuous improvement of AI systems in production

Requirements

3+ years of professional experience in AI / ML or software engineering roles

Strong proficiency in Python

Hands‑on experience with machine learning, NLP, or LLM‑based systems

Experience deploying ML models or AI services into production

Experience building and integrating RESTful APIs

Familiarity with cloud platforms (Azure, AWS, or GCP)

Understanding of CI/CD pipelines and production reliability

Strong problem‑solving skills and a product‑oriented mindset

Excellent collaboration and communication skills
